Course Details
• Travel Risk Management: An overview of the policies, procedures, and strategies to mitigate travel-related risks. This unit covers risk identification, assessment, and control, as well as the importance of a strong travel risk management plan. • Crisis Preparedness: This unit focuses on building a culture of resilience and preparedness within a travel program. It covers the creation and maintenance of crisis management plans, as well as training and exercising to ensure readiness. • Medical Emergency Response: A focus on medical emergencies, including the preparation, response, and management of medical incidents abroad. This unit covers medical evacuation, repatriation, and travel health. • Safety & Security: This unit addresses safety and security risks, including crime, terrorism, and natural disasters. It covers risk mitigation strategies, emergency response procedures, and post-incident recovery. • Communication & Coordination: Effective communication and coordination are critical during a crisis. This unit covers internal and external communication strategies, as well as the importance of collaboration with key stakeholders. • Legal & Regulatory Compliance: An overview of the legal and regulatory requirements for travel crisis management, including data privacy, duty of care, and international laws. • Travel Risk Technology: This unit explores the role of technology in travel risk management, including the use of data analytics, travel risk information platforms, and mobile applications. • Incident Management: This unit focuses on the practical aspects of managing a crisis, including incident reporting, situation assessment, decision-making, and resource allocation. • Post-Crisis Review & Improvement: The importance of conducting post-crisis reviews and implementing improvements to enhance future crisis preparedness and response. This unit covers lessons learned, best practices, and continuous improvement strategies.
